Bound Print, Designs for Cartouches
This is a Bound print. It was designed by Gilles-Marie Oppenord and published by Charles Auguste Foulard and Gabriel Huquier and print maker: Gabriel Huquier. It is dated ca. 1900 and we acquired it in 1920. Its medium is photomechanical print. It is a part of the Drawings, Prints, and Graphic Design department.
It is credited Purchased for the Museum by the Advisory Council.
It is signed
Lettered lower left, in plate: Oppenort inv.; Lettered lower right, in plate: Huquier Sculp.et ex.
It is inscribed
Printed upper left, in plate: E; Printed upper right, in plate: 6; Printed lower center, in plate: Avec privilége du Roi.; Inscribed in graphite, lower right, in margin: 1921-6-230(32)
